About Deerfield

Deerfield is a 18-hole golf course located in Newark, Delaware (19711).. From the Blue tees, the course plays to 6,323 yards with a par of 70. The Blue tees carry a slope rating of 131 and a course rating of 71.0.

Walking is permitted.

Deerfield offers a moderately challenging layout with a slope rating of 138, putting it in the upper half of courses in Delaware for difficulty. The course provides a fair test for golfers of most skill levels.

The course offers 6 tee sets ranging from 5,348 to 6,323 yards, making it accessible to golfers of all skill levels. Choosing the right tees for your handicap is the single biggest factor in how much you enjoy your round.

What would a 15-handicap shoot at Deerfield?expand_more

A 15-handicap golfer playing the White-Gold Hybrid tees (slope 130, rating 68.2) at Deerfield would have a course handicap of 15 and an expected score of approximately 85. This is calculated using the USGA World Handicap System formula: Course Handicap = Handicap Index × (Slope / 113) + (Course Rating − Par).
